Transaction 80b80e19e006d96f7df6333286b10745470de3a789b967763e05c99bf702e7f5
1 Input
1 Output
-
80b80e19e006d96f7df6333286b10745470de3a789b967763e05c99bf702e7f5:0
- value
- 197649
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b4fa565992a862b383711d478f0b59a433b8e68
- address
- bc1q3d862eve92rzkwphz8283u94nfpnhrngdyz4ua